Lucy Kellogg 1802–1882 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 1 Jun 1802

Birth Location: Galaway, Saratoga, New York, USA

Death Date: 1882

Death Location: Eaton Rapids, Eaton, Michigan, USA

Father: Stephen Kellogg

Mother: Lucy Weldon

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

The story of Lucy Kellogg began in 1802 in Galaway, Saratoga, New York, USA. Lucy Kellogg passed away in 1882 in Eaton Rapids, Eaton, Michigan, USA.
